Transaction ae18fdc6e10bd9fad93565647788f35a67cb50a4643b64780b3111f95dd7b375

30 Input
1 Outputs
  • ae18fdc6e10bd9fad93565647788f35a67cb50a4643b64780b3111f95dd7b375:0
  • value  76379593
    address  1G47mSr3oANXMafVrR8UC4pzV7FEAzo3r9